The octopus by Frank Norris dramatized the conflicts over land between the wheat farmers in the West ( San Joaquin valley )against the power monopolized southern and pacific railroad companies.
The dramatization by Frank Norris was expressed through the technique of literary naturalism when he wrote the novel. the conflicts were mainly over the used of lands belonging to the wheat farmers by the railroad companies for the construction and operation of the rail system transportation. The farmers wanted their land for the cultivation of wheat while the companies wanted the land for construction of rail lines .

De jure is used to describe something or a law that legally exist or recognized. Being recognized however, does not mean it is practiced. For example, the fundamental human right in most countries exists only as a law but they are not being practiced. The citizens of such countries may know those laws as rights. That is, they know the laws exist, but it does not necessarily mean they are practiced.
